India, Sept. 24 -- Pakistan Prime Minister Muhammad Shehbaz Sharif on Tuesday attended the meeting of Arab Islamic leaders hosted by US President Donald Trump and Emir of Qatar H.E. Sheikh Tamim Bin Hamad Al Thani.

The meeting was held in New York on the sidelines of the high-level 80th session of the UN General Assembly. Trump first addressed the UNGA on Tuesday morning, then attended the meeting with Arab Islamic leaders.

This meeting was focused on ending the ongoing war in Gaza and reaching a permanent ceasefire, news agency Reuters reported, citing, Emirati state news agency.

The news agency said releasing all hostages and taking steps towards addressing the worsening humanitarian crisis in the war-torn enclave were also discussed...
